Capitec Bank invites recent IT graduates to apply for a structured Software Engineering Training Program designed to bridge the gap between academic learning and practical experience.
This 12-month development program provides hands-on exposure to real-world projects, professional mentorship, and a pathway to launching a career in the financial technology sector.
Location: Stellenbosch, Western Cape
Duration: 12 Months
Closing Date: 15 March 2025

Who Should Apply?
This opportunity is open to recent graduates who:
- Have completed a tertiary qualification in Information Technology or Computer Science within the last three years.
- Are eager to apply theoretical knowledge to real-world software engineering.
- Have basic knowledge of office systems, tools, and coding practices.
- Have a keen interest in banking, software engineering, and financial technology.
- Salesforce exposure or certification is a plus but not required.
Minimum Requirements
- A relevant tertiary qualification in:
- BSc in Information Technology
- BCom in Computer Science
- Other relevant IT-related degrees
- Strong problem-solving, organizational, and analytical skills.
- Ability to work in a fast-paced, team-oriented environment.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, Outlook).
- Strong attention to detail and adaptability.
- No prior work experience required, but previous internships are advantageous.
- Clear criminal and credit record (as per financial sector regulations).
